.NET Micro Framework for Linux: The .NET Micro Framework for Linux is a small, free and open-source platform by Microsoft that allows writing .NET applications for resource-constrained devices running Linux. It includes a small version of the .NET runtime and libraries.

RealCalc Scientific Calculator: RealCalc is a free scientific calculator app for Android. It provides advanced mathematical functions like trigonometry, logarithms, fractions, permutations, statistics, and more. The clean interface allows for efficient calculation.

.NET Micro Framework for Linux
.NET Micro Framework for Linux Features
  • Small memory footprint
  • Supports C# and Visual Basic development
  • Integrated with Visual Studio
  • Supports GPIO, I2C, SPI, UART peripherals
  • Real-time deterministic garbage collection
  • Cryptography and SSL/TLS support
